MEMO — Kettling Depot Receiving

Uniform sets for the new Kettling depot arrive Wednesday via Ashgrove courier: 40 boxes, sorted by size, manifest attached to box one. Check the count at the dock before signing; shortages go straight to stores, not the courier. The hand-over instruction the courier will follow is set out below.

drop instructions, tafof-baguf: the holmir gilox courier leaves the sormir ulaok holdor ledger at gate 5596 under passcode 257343

## Runbook: Cron drift on Marrowgate schedulers

If nightly jobs start firing late, it's almost always clock drift on the scheduler hosts, not the cron daemon itself. First compare host time against the internal time source, then check whether the sync agent restarted recently. Don't reschedule jobs manually — let the queue catch up. The scheduler's current settings are shown here.

settings of tagef-bawif:
DRUIX_HOST=druix.zemvarlabs.internal
DRUIX_PORT=8000

Minutes — Q3 Cash-Flow Forecast, Brindlewood Foods mgmt call. Attendees: Marta, Deke, Priya. Receivables from the Larchport accounts slipped two weeks; Deke will chase. Forecast still shows positive cover through October, tighter in November. Marta wants weekly updates until the Kestrel launch lands. One more thing before we circulate the deck.

internal memo for yahap-hahig: The western region missed its Casax quota by 18.1 percent last quarter. Belvanek Partners plans to raise the Oliael list price by 58.8 percent in September. The board signed off on a budget of $165.5 million for Project Ulaok. The renewal with Ralirox Holdings closes at $376.9 million a year, 32.2 percent above the last contract.

## Support

TilePump is the map-tile prefetcher used by the Farrow navigation client. For the weekly eng sync: prefetch queue depth and cache hit rates are on the Grafview dashboard under "tilepump-prod". Known issue — aggressive prefetch during zoom transitions can spike bandwidth; a throttle fix lands next sprint. Ownership sits with the Routing Infra pod; on-call rotation covers evenings and weekends. For questions outside sync hours, or to escalate a prefetch incident, reach the team at the address below.

escalation mailbox, yafog-kafof: eliok@xolmarcloud.local